Understanding Common Types of Window Damage

Before reaching out to a professional for window repair, it's vital to identify the type of damage present. Below is a table describing common window issues and their normal causes.

Kind of DamageDescriptionTypical Causes
Broken or Broken GlassVisible damage to the glass pane.Impact from particles, weather condition modifications.
Drafty WindowsFeeling of cold air or drafts coming through the frame.Incorrect sealing or worn-out weatherstripping.
Foggy or Cloudy WindowsCondensation between double or triple-pane glass.Seal failure, temperature level fluctuations.
Harmed Window FrameVisible cracks or warping.Moisture damage, bug invasions.
Faulty OperationWindows that stick, jam, or will not open.Dirt accumulation, misalignment, or broken hardware.

Recognizing these issues can help house owners communicate their needs to a professional more effectively.

Costs of Professional Window Repair

The cost of window repair can differ considerably based on numerous elements, such as the kind of damage, the window materials, and the extent of needed repairs. Below is a table that describes typical price varieties, though specific figures can vary by area and service company.

Type of RepairEstimated Cost
Glass Replacement₤ 200 - ₤ 800 per pane
Frame Repair₤ 150 - ₤ 500 per frame
Sealant Replacement₤ 100 - ₤ 300
Complete Window Replacement₤ 300 - ₤ 1,200 per window

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. How do I know if my window needs repairs or replacement?

If your window exhibits several indications of damage, such as cracks, drafts, or fogginess, it may deserve assessing whether repair or replacement is more economical. Consulting with a professional can provide clarity.

2. Can I repair my windows myself?

While some small issues can be handled by DIY lovers, substantial damage frequently needs specialized tools and competence. Working with a professional can ensure that repairs are done correctly and safely.

3. How long do window repairs generally take?

The duration of window repairs depends upon the level of the damage. Minor repairs may take a couple of hours, while more substantial repairs might take a day or longer.

4. Is it worth it to repair older windows?

If the frame and structure of older windows are still sound, repairing them can be a cost-effective alternative to replacement. Nevertheless, if they are substantially worn or inefficient, replacement might be the much better choice.

5. How can I avoid window damage in the future?

Routine maintenance, such as cleaning, resealing, and examining for indications of wear or damage, can considerably extend the life of your windows.
